    It's a 2 part system. The first is a Shampoo that contains CAF/KETOCON/FINASTERIDE and you simply use it like a regular shampoo once per day and leave it in your hair for 1-3 minutes and then rinse. Then twice per day you apply another foam product to your hair which is MINOX/AZELAIC ACID. I've been taking it for about 3 months now and it's slowly working. My hair is def. a bit thicker (although, I do have short hair) and I would def. say it's slowly working. That said, I'm not bald by any means but I just want to ensure I don't start receeding my hairline.

    I dont think fina is active topically so Im pretty sure you could do your own thing there and make it better. Like a ketoconizole (nizoral) shampoo, a topical spironolactone and the a generic rogaine. So you would shampoo with nizoral and treat with spriro to enact as anti androgens on the scalp itself and then the rogine acts as a vasodilator at the scalp as well.

    Basic facts - testosterone may cause hair loss if predisposed to MPB. Prolonged low testosterone may also cause hair loss if predisposed to MPB. In either case, you are predisposed to MPB, meaning at some point the hair was going to fall out, although it may fall out sooner than it would have had either of the prior mentioned factors not been at play.
